How they compare

Switzerland currently reports 5.52 million constant 2015 US$ per square kilometre against 4.16 million constant 2015 US$ per square kilometre in Belgium, a difference of 1.36 million constant 2015 US$ per square kilometre.

That makes Switzerland's figure about 1.3 times Belgium's.

Across all 24 years both countries report, Switzerland has been ahead every year.

Belgium ranks 12th and Switzerland ranks 9th of 159 countries.

Switzerland has averaged higher in every one of the 3 decades both report.
